Artist Biography
Available in: gb icon
Alexander John "Alex" Ligertwood is a Scottish singer, guitarist and drummer. he is best known as the lead vocalist of Santana on hits such as "All I Ever Wanted", "You Know That I Love You", "Winning" and "Hold On". He has also performed with The Jeff Beck Group, The Senate, Brian Auger's Oblivion Express and the Average White Band and provided vocals for David Sancious.
Ligertwood also sang lead vocals on "Crank It Up", a track by The Dixie Dregs, on their 1982 album Industry Standard, as well as lead vocal on "Double Bad" from Jeff Lorber's 1984 album In the Heat of the Night. In the mid-2000s, he toured with World Classic Rockers, and most recently sang on a version of the Scorpions classic Is There Anybody There on former Scorpions drummer Herman Rarebell's solo album Acoustic Fever in 2013.
